O futuro do desenvolvimento Web na era da Inteligência Artificial

No atual panorama digital, o desenvolvimento Web está a sofrer uma profunda transformação, em grande parte impulsionada pelos rápidos avanços da Inteligência Artificial (IA). As evoluções das tecnologias baseadas em IA remodelam a formas tradicionais como os websites a as aplicações web são concebidas, projectadas e mantidas.

Este artigo explora o futuro do desenvolvimento Web no contexto da IA, destacando as principais tendências, os potenciais benefícios e os desafios que os programadores Web e as empresas enfrentarão nesta nova era.

A ascensão das ferramentas de desenvolvimento Web baseadas em IA

A ascensão das ferramentas de desenvolvimento Web baseadas em IA começou em 2015, com avanços na aprendizagem automática, no processamento de linguagem natural e na aprendizagem profunda. Antes de 2015, a utilização de ferramentas de IA no desenvolvimento Web ainda estava na sua fase inicial, no entanto, havia algumas tendências e ferramentas emergentes que estavam a começar a incorporar caraterísticas semelhantes às da IA ou que eram precursoras das modernas ferramentas de desenvolvimento Web baseadas na IA. Algumas dessas ferramentas eram:

  • Algoritmos de aprendizagem automática para analisar padrões de pesquisa e sugerir optimizações,
  • Os chatbots baseados em regras estavam a ser implementados em alguns sítios Web para apoio ao cliente,
  • Ferramentas de teste A/B que utilizavam a análise estatística para otimizar a conceção e o conteúdo da Web,
  • A análise da Web, como o Google Analytics, estava a tornar-se mais sofisticada na análise do comportamento dos utilizadores,
  • E algumas plataformas CMS estavam a começar a experimentar funções básicas de IA para organizar e etiquetar conteúdos.

Atualmente, a indústria do web design em geral adoptou a nova tecnologia de IA como forma de simplificar tarefas monótonas, experimentar novas estratégias de design, identificar formas de melhorar a experiência do utilizador e até auditar e acompanhar os seus projectos de web design.

A integração da IA no desenvolvimento Web

  1. Ferramentas de design alimentadas por IA

Um dos impactos mais significativos da IA no desenvolvimento Web é o aparecimento de ferramentas de design alimentadas por IA. Estas ferramentas utilizam algoritmos de aprendizagem automática para automatizar e otimizar o processo de design, permitindo aos programadores criar interfaces visualmente apelativas e fáceis de utilizar de forma rápida e eficiente. Por exemplo, a IA pode analisar o comportamento e as preferências do utilizador para recomendar elementos de design que melhorem a experiência do utilizador, melhorando, em última análise, o design UI/UX. Esta integração da IA no design acelera o processo de desenvolvimento e garante que os websites sejam altamente adaptados ao público-alvo.

As ferramentas de design baseadas em IA podem gerar automaticamente layouts, selecionar esquemas de cores e até criar modelos de websites completos com base nas preferências do utilizador e nas melhores práticas. Isto facilita aos programadores e designers a criação rápida de websites visualmente apelativos e funcionais.

De acordo com um estudo da HubSpot (uma empresa criadora de produtos de software para marketing, vendas e serviço ao cliente) 93% dos web designers utilizaram uma ferramenta ou tecnologia de IA para ajudar numa tarefa relacionada com o seu trabalho e 50% destes designers utilizaram a IA para a criação de sítios Web de ponta a ponta.

 

  1. Codificação e depuração automatizadas

A IA está também a fazer progressos significativos na fase de codificação do desenvolvimento Web. As ferramentas de geração automática de código, alimentadas por processamento de linguagem natural (PNL) e aprendizagem automática, permitem aos programadores escrever código de forma mais eficiente.

As ferramentas alimentadas por IA, como o GitHub Copilot, podem sugerir trechos de código, escrever secções inteiras de código ou mesmo criar aplicações simples com base em descrições de linguagem natural. Além disso, as ferramentas de depuração baseadas em IA podem identificar e corrigir erros no código mais rapidamente do que os métodos tradicionais, reduzindo o tempo gasto na resolução de problemas e melhorando a qualidade geral do código. A automatização destes processos minimiza a margem de erro humano além de, aumentar a produtividade.

Os websites que tiram partido da IA para a personalização têm maior probabilidade de manter os utilizadores envolvidos e satisfeitos

O papel da IA na personalização e na Experiência do Utilizador (UX)

  1. Personalização dinâmica de conteúdos

A personalização, na atualidade, tornou-se uma pedra angular no desenvolvimento de website, a IA é força motriz por trás desse modelo de serviço. Os algoritmos de IA podem analisar grandes quantidades de dados do utilizador, incluindo o histórico de navegação, a localização e os padrões de comportamento, para fornecer conteúdo personalizado em tempo real.

Esta personalização dinâmica de conteúdos garante que os utilizadores recebem informações relevantes, o que melhora a sua experiência geral e aumenta a probabilidade de conversões. Os websites que tiram partido da IA para a personalização têm maior probabilidade de manter os utilizadores envolvidos e satisfeitos, o que conduz a taxas de retenção mais elevadas.

 

  1. Chatbots e assistentes virtuais com IA

A integração de chatbots e assistentes virtuais orientados com IA em websites está a tornar-se cada vez mais comum. Estas ferramentas podem tratar as questões dos clientes, prestar apoio e orientar os utilizadores através de processos complexos, ao mesmo tempo que aprendem e melhoram com cada interação. A utilização da IA nos chatbots não só melhora o serviço ao cliente, como também liberta os recursos humanos para se concentrarem em tarefas mais complexas. Espera-se que estes chatbots se tornem ainda mais sofisticados, oferecendo interações mais personalizadas e eficientes com os utilizadores enquanto a tecnologia de IA continue a melhorar.

O impacto da IA no SEO e no Marketing Digital

  1. Otimização mais inteligente dos motores de pesquisa (SEO)

A IA está a desempenhar um papel fundamental na evolução da otimização dos motores de pesquisa (SEO). As ferramentas alimentadas por IA podem analisar os algoritmos dos motores de pesquisa e o comportamento dos utilizadores para fornecer estratégias de SEO mais precisas e eficazes. Isto inclui a otimização do conteúdo para a pesquisa por voz, a melhoria da segmentação por palavras-chave e a melhoria da estrutura do site para uma melhor indexação por motores de pesquisa como o Google.

Enquanto a IA continua a evoluir, desempenhará um papel ainda mais significativo na definição das melhores práticas de SEO, ajudando os websites a obter uma classificação mais elevada e a atrair mais tráfego orgânico.

 

  1. Análise preditiva para marketing

Ao analisar grandes conjuntos de dados e identificar padrões, a IA pode prever tendências, otimizar a colocação de anúncios e personalizar mensagens de marketing com base no comportamento do utilizador. Este nível de conhecimento permite às empresas tomar decisões mais informadas e criar campanhas de marketing mais eficazes.

Como resultado, os websites que incorporam estratégias de marketing orientadas para a IA têm probabilidades de ver taxas de envolvimento mais elevadas e um melhor ROI dos seus esforços de marketing.

Preocupações: Os Desafios e as Considerações Éticas

  1. Preocupações com a proteção de dados

À medida que a IA se torna mais integrada no desenvolvimento da Web, as preocupações com a proteção dos dados estão a aumentar. Os sistemas de IA dependem frequentemente de grandes quantidades de dados do utilizador para funcionarem eficazmente, o que levanta questões sobre a forma como estes dados são recolhidos, armazenados e utilizados.

Os desenvolvedores devem enfrentar esses desafios implementando medidas robustas de proteção de dados e garantindo a conformidade com regulamentos como o GDPR. Garantir a transparência e práticas de dados éticas será crucial para manter a confiança dos utilizadores em websites orientados com IA.

 

  1. O risco de deslocação dos postos de trabalho

A automatização da codificação, do design e de outras tarefas de desenvolvimento Web pela IA apresenta o risco de deslocação de postos de trabalho. Embora a IA possa aumentar a eficiência, também ameaça reduzir a procura de determinadas funções no sector. No entanto, é essencial notar que a IA também está a criar novas oportunidades, como a necessidade de especialistas em IA e o desenvolvimento de novas ferramentas orientadas com IA.

Considerações finais

Os Desafios

O futuro do desenvolvimento web na era da IA é simultaneamente tanto estimulante quanto incerto. Por um lado, a IA tem o potencial de revolucionar a indústria, tornando o desenvolvimento web mais rápido, mais eficiente e mais personalizado. Por outro lado, apresenta desafios significativos, particularmente em termos de proteção de dados e dos postos de trabalho.

A capacidade da IA para automatizar muitos aspectos do desenvolvimento Web pode levar à deslocação de empregos para determinadas funções. Embora a IA possa lidar com tarefas de rotina, pode reduzir a procura de cargos de nível básico, levando os programadores a melhorar as suas competências e a concentrarem-se em aspectos mais complexos e criativos do desenvolvimento.

Conforme a IA torna-se cada vez mais predominante, o conjunto de competências necessárias para os programadores Web irá evoluir. Os programadores terão de aprender a trabalhar em conjunto com a IA, incluindo a compreensão dos modelos de aprendizagem automática, a análise de dados e as ferramentas orientadas para a IA. Esta mudança poderá criar um fosso entre os que se adaptam às novas tecnologias e os que não o fazem.

O Sucesso no Futuro do Desenvolvimento Web

A chave para o sucesso no futuro do desenvolvimento Web reside em encontrar um equilíbrio entre o aproveitamento dos benefícios da IA e a atenuação dos seus riscos. Para tal, será necessária uma abordagem multifacetada:

  • Educação e formação: A aprendizagem contínua e a atualização de competências serão essenciais para os programadores acompanharem os avanços da IA. Os programas de formação devem centrar-se na literacia em IA, em considerações éticas e na integração de ferramentas de IA nas práticas de desenvolvimento web.
  • Desenvolvimento ético da IA: As empresas precisam de dar prioridade ao desenvolvimento ético da IA, garantindo que os seus sistemas de IA são transparentes, responsáveis e isentos de preconceitos. Isto inclui a implementação de processos rigorosos de teste e validação e a realização de auditorias regulares às ferramentas de IA.
  • Conceção centrada no utilizador: Os programadores devem concentrar-se na utilização da IA para criar experiências Web mais intuitivas, acessíveis e personalizadas, respeitando simultaneamente a privacidade e as preferências dos utilizadores.
  • Colaboração entre humanos e IA: Em vez de ver a IA como um substituto para os programadores humanos, deve ser vista como uma ferramenta poderosa que pode aumentar a criatividade humana e a resolução de problemas. Os melhores resultados virão provavelmente de uma abordagem colaborativa, em que a IA trata das tarefas de rotina e os humanos se concentram nos aspectos estratégicos, criativos e éticos do desenvolvimento.

A integração da IA no desenvolvimento Web não é apenas uma tendência; é o que vai definir os novos modelos de trabalho no sector. Conforme as tecnologias de IA continuam a avançar, desempenharão um papel cada vez mais central na definição da forma como os websites e as aplicações serão desenvolvidos no futuro. Os programadores Web e as empresas que adoptarem estas mudanças estarão melhor posicionados para prosperar no panorama digital do futuro. No entanto, é crucial abordar este futuro com cautela, assegurando que as considerações éticas e os potenciais riscos são cuidadosamente geridos.

Este site utiliza cookies próprias  para o seu correto funcionamento.  Ao Aceitar, concorda com o uso de estas tecnologías e o processamento dos seus dados para melhorar a sua experiencia de navegação.   
Privacidad